Abstract

A push wave transmission unit transmits a push wave to a biological tissue of a subject. A tracking wave transmission/reception unit transmits a tracking wave to the biological tissue and receives a reflected ultrasound wave reflected by the biological tissue. An elasticity analysis unit measures a propagation velocity of a shear wave generated in the biological tissue by the push wave and measures an elastic property of the biological tissue based on the propagation velocity, and measures the propagation velocity of the shear wave based on a measurement signal obtained by the reflected ultrasound wave received by the tracking wave transmission/reception unit. A controller determines whether to re-measure the elastic property according to an unnecessary component included in the measurement signal. When determining to re-measure the elastic property, the ultrasound diagnostic apparatus re-measures the elastic property by changing an acoustic property of the push wave according to the unnecessary component.
